The courts have generally held that direct taxes are limited to taxes on people (variously called capitation, poll tax or head tax) and property. (Penn Mutual Indemnity Organization. v. C.I.R., 227 F.2d 16, 19-20 (3rd Cir. 1960).) All the taxes are typically called "indirect taxes," within their tax an event, rather than a person or property by itself. (Steward Machine Co. v. Davis, 301 U.S. 548, 581-582 (1937).) What seemed to be a straightforward limitation on the power of the legislature based on the main topic of the tax proved inexact and unclear when applied for income tax, which could be arguably viewed either as a direct or an indirect tax.

A tax deduction, or "write off" as it's sometimes called, reduces your taxable income by letting you to subtract number of an expense from your income, before calculating the amount tax you must pay. Higher deductions you have or the larger the deductions, the your taxable income. Also, higher you get rid of your taxable income the less exposure you are going to the higher tax rates in find income mounting brackets. As you read earlier, Canada's tax system is progressive thus the more you earn, the higher the tax rate. Losing taxable income cuts down on the amount of tax you will pay.
